With anti-Semitic hate crimes on the rise, the Jewish community came together on Sunday at the Holocaust Museum in Los Angeles to remember loved ones who perished in the Holocaust.For the first time in four years, the museum held the event in Fairfax. The event had been canceled the past few years due to the pandemic.
Speakers and survivors spoke about the horrors of the Holocaust and maintaining hope, even though six million Jewish people died in the genocide.
